No one can force me to campaign for NPP; not even Agya Koo – Wayoosi

As the December 7th elections approach, some people are bracing themselves to cash out this period since politicians would be visiting them to beg for their votes.

During this period popular celebrities are not left out as they are approached by politicians to join in their campaign train to get their fans to vote for them to come into power for the next four years.

Popular Kumawood actor Wayoosi has stated emphatically that he would never campaign for the ruling New Patriotic Party(NPP) when his service is needed.

According to him, people tend to lose their respect after openly declaring their political affiliation and that is something he doesn’t want to happen to him.

He went on to say that his family has over the years commanded respect from people and wouldn’t want to do anything that would make his family lose such respect.

Wayoosi whose real name is Joseph Osei revealed that not even celebrated veteran actor Agya Koo whom he respects a lot in the industry can force him to join his ‘Agenda 57’ group to campaign for Nana Addo and the NPP.

Sharing an experience he encountered, the comic actor revealed that one big man he cherishes big-time started avoiding him after he openly revealed that he was a huge supporter of Kumasi Asante Kotoko.

He went on to say due to this, he learned his lesson and promised never to engage himself in showing his affiliation publicly.

In other news, Wayoosi after battling with a kidney problem for some years has stated that henceforth he is no more going to take in alcohol or meat again since those are the things that contributed to his illness.

He disclosed that he is now stuck to eating vegetarian foods since that was what saved him from having dialysis and destroying other vital organs in his system.
